The Perfect Hamburger

Source: William Sonoma Website
SERVERS: 4
PREP TIME:
~30 min
COOKING TIME: ~10 min

LetsEat070502

Notes:

For health reasons, all ground meat should be cooked at least to the medium-well stage.

 

Instructions

Prepare a charcoal or gas grill for direct grilling over medium-high heat.

In a large bowl, mix together the beef, yellow onion, garlic, salt, pepper and Worcestershire sauce.

Form the mixture into 4 patties, each 3⁄4 inch thick.

Grill the hamburgers directly over medium-high heat, 3 to 5 minutes on the first side.

Turn over and cook the opposite side, 3 to5 minutes (If making cheeseburgers, place a slice of cheese on top of each hamburger) and toast the hamburger buns, cut side down, on the grill.

Check for doneness by cutting into a hamburger near the center (no pink should show on the inside) or

testing with an instant-read thermometer (at least 160°F for medium-well)

Serve the hamburgers on the buns with tomato, white onion, lettuce, dill pickle and condiments.

 

Ingredient List

  • 1 lb. ground lean beef
  • 2 Tbs. finely chopped yellow onion
  • 1 tsp. minced garlic
  • 1 tsp. salt
  • 1/2 tsp. freshly ground pepper
  • 2 dashes of Worcestershire sauce
  • 4 hamburger buns, split
  • Sliced tomato for serving
  • Sliced sweet white onion, such as Maui, Vidalia or Walla Walla, for serving
  • Torn lettuce for serving
  • Sliced dill pickle for serving
  • Ketchup, mayonnaise, mustard or other condiments of your choice for serving
  • 4 slices cheddar or Swiss cheese (optional)

For an Asian twist, omit the Worcestershire sauce and salt, add a dash of soy sauce, and use chopped green onion instead of yellow onion.

For a French-style hamburger, omit the Worcestershire sauce, halve the salt, and add 1 Tbs. each of crumbled blue cheese and chopped mushrooms along with a dash of red wine.

For a Provencal flavor, omit the Worcestershire sauce, double the garlic, and add 1 Tbs. each of chopped dried tomatoes and pitted black olives.
